Output 2625903ef9ba4a35c260d56e19980fe3149917a82e3b14e0cfafd560ac1721f6:0

value
16000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fef69867bd69df997c24aab3cd03c33eea76f41 OP_EQUAL
address
34bsg9D8roDnF4x1HeTHxZBXqtKebsSmgY
transaction
2625903ef9ba4a35c260d56e19980fe3149917a82e3b14e0cfafd560ac1721f6
spent
true